エ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
クエリ実行計画 - MONEX ENGINEER BLOG │マネックス エンジニアブログ
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
クエリ実行計画 - MONEX ENGINEER BLOG │マネックス エンジニアブログ
はじめに こんにちは。システム開発一部の大宮です。 皆さんが図書館で本を探す場合どのようにして探す... はじめに こんにちは。システム開発一部の大宮です。 皆さんが図書館で本を探す場合どのようにして探すでしょうか。 端から端まで隅々見て本を探すでしょうか。 図書館にある本が3冊とかであればそれでいいですが何万冊もあれば現実的ではないですね。 出版社で探したり、作者名だったり、ジャンルだったりと探したい本や蔵書数などの状況によって最適な探し方があると思います。 SQLでも同じように探し方が悪い場合途方もない時間待つことになるため、 データベースから最適な探し方でデータを取得する必要があります。 実行したSQLが最適であるかはクエリの実行計画を利用することで確認することができます。 今回はそんな実行計画についてPostgreSQLを例にお話ししていこうと思います。 SQLの仕組み 実行計画の詳細は一旦置いておいて、SQLがどのように実行されているのかを抽象的にでも理解しておくことが重要です。おお